“Where is the Justice?” – Song ka Background

“Where is the Justice?” ek song hai jo Death Note Musical ka part hai. Ye musical, Tsugumi Ohba aur Takeshi Obata ke original Death Note manga/anime pe based hai. Frank Wildhorn ne iska music compose kiya hai aur iska English version Broadway-style hai.

Ye song Light Yagami ka solo performance hai, jisme wo apni justice ki definition express karta hai. Is song me Light society ke flawed justice system ko criticize karta hai aur apne aap ko ek Messiah ki tarah dekhta hai jo ek naye duniya ka nirmaan karega.

3. Justice Ka Subjective Nature

Death Note ka biggest question hai – Justice ka real definition kya hai? Kya Light ka method sahi hai?

Light believe karta hai ki wo ek naya world order create kar raha hai, par L aur baki law enforcers usko ek criminal maante hain.

Ye show karta hai ki justice har insaan ki perspective pe depend karta hai. Koi bhi apni morality ko justify kar sakta hai, chahe uska method unethical ho.
